About Program

United Planet's Quest Volunteer Abroad program offers you or your group a life-changing opportunity to interact with local communities through customized work experiences, cultural activities, and home stays. United Planet Quests are offered in more than 25 countries from 1-52 weeks.

Volunteer opportunities in Tanzania include interacting with local service providers in a wide range of services.

Opportunities include volunteering to work at schools or educational centers, work with urban children, and healthcare programs including working at centers for people in need of specialized care like a children’s cancer ward, a home for the disabled, and a center for mentally handicapped youth.

Ilula Orphan Program -- Tanzania

I volunteered at Ilula Orphan Program (IOP) in the Iringa Region in Southwest Tanzania for two months during the summer of 2011. I stayed in the orphanage and helped teach English and math at the local schools, organized sporting events for local children, and held day camps at the villages around IOP. I am so fortunate United Planet has a partnership with such an amazing program. I felt very safe traveling and living at IOP -- it is a gated facility with a guard 24/7. On weekends, we would travel to the local town of Iringa where we would eat lunch out, and use the internet to contact our families. IOP is also an incredible program -- I really felt like I made an impact, and I really connected with the girls who lived at the orphanage. It was an absolutely amazing way to experience the unique Tanzanian culture. Although I stayed for 8 weeks, I stayed an extra week; visiting the beautiful beaches of Zanzibar and Sleous Game Reserve for a safari. I highly recommend this incredible program!!!
